i play "everquest 2", which is pretty good but there is no pvp and pvp can make or break a game. It depends on what you want though. "Everquest 2" is good if you dont want pvp. If you do want pvp i would suggest "dark age of camalot". "World of warcraft" is good for the lower levels but its starts to suck and get boring as you get to higher levels. You can also play anarchy online, which is free to download and play the original game, its an ok game but the free part makes it pretty good for those who dont play often. If you do decide to download it, download it from fileplanet or something similar to that because otherwise you'd have to use bit torrent whiach takes many hours to download with. good luck to you finding the right game.
